Don't forget that 4 July is blacked out for all but the most expensive AP, you will probably find the 5th blacked out as well. For this reason in 2006 when the 4th was midweek it was the quietest day of our stay, however with the 4th making a long weekend I would not expect the same. Do not leave the park after midday as you may not get back in....
